The ADAGP donates $2 from every ticket sold to the Auto Dealers CARing for Kids Foundation. The foundation uses the funds for programs benefiting area children like its Driving Away the Cold effort, which provides brand new winter coats to kids that need them the most. The Philadelphia Auto Show also has two Deaf & Hard of Hearing Community Access events during the 2017 show on Jan 28 from 9 A.M to 3 P.M and January 31 from 4 P.M to 9 P.M .
